Comuna Liţa, Teleorman, Romania

Overview

Comuna Liţa is a small collection of rural villages in the heart of Teleorman, southern Romania. Life moves at a gentle pace, centered around farming, close community, and Romanian traditions. It's a destination for experiencing authentic rural culture and laid-back countryside charm.

Best Time to Visit

May to September for pleasant weather and green landscapes.

Local Tips

Public transport is infrequent; consider renting a car to explore the area. Cash is used more than cards, so bring local currency.

Cultural Etiquette

Greet locals politely; it's customary to say 'Bună ziua.' Dress modestly, especially in and around churches. Tipping in restaurants is appreciated but not obligatory.

Safety Warnings

Comuna Liţa is very safe with very low crime. Beware of stray dogs in some areas and watch for agricultural vehicles on rural roads.

Hidden Gems

Walk the country paths between hamlets, visit the Orthodox churches, and try fresh produce from local farmers.
